1. YOUR RIGHT TO CANCEL AN ONLINE ORDER

If you are a consumer purchasing goods online, you normally have a statutory right to cancel your order without giving a reason.

You may notify us that you wish to cancel your order at any time from the date the contract is formed until 14 days after the day on which you, or a person nominated by you other than the carrier, receives the goods.

If an order contains multiple items delivered separately, the cancellation period generally ends 14 days after the day on which you receive the final item.

You do not need to provide a reason for exercising your statutory right to cancel.

8. FAULTY, DAMAGED OR MISDESCRIBED GOODS

Your rights regarding faulty goods are separate from your right to cancel an online order.

Under UK consumer law, goods supplied by us must, where applicable:

  • be of satisfactory quality;

  • be fit for their intended or agreed purpose;

  • match their description;

  • match any sample or model provided where legally applicable; and

  • meet other applicable statutory requirements.

9. 30-DAY SHORT-TERM RIGHT TO REJECT FAULTY GOODS

Under the Consumer Rights Act 2015, consumers normally have a 30-day short-term right to reject goods that do not conform to the contract.

Where this statutory right applies and is validly exercised, you may be entitled to reject the goods and receive a refund.

This right relates to faulty or non-conforming products and should not be confused with the separate 14-day cancellation right applicable to many online purchases.


10. FAULTS DISCOVERED AFTER 30 DAYS

If a fault is discovered after the statutory short-term right to reject has expired, you may still have legal remedies.

Depending on the circumstances, you may be entitled to request a:

  • repair; or

  • replacement.

The remedy must be provided within a reasonable time and without significant inconvenience to the consumer where required by law.

If repair or replacement is impossible, unsuccessful, unavailable within a reasonable time, or would cause significant inconvenience, you may have a right to:

  • an appropriate price reduction; or

  • exercise the final right to reject the goods and receive a refund, subject to the applicable statutory rules.

Additional statutory rights may continue beyond the periods described above.

13. EXCEPTIONS TO THE RIGHT TO CANCEL

UK consumer law provides certain exceptions to the statutory right to cancel distance contracts.

Depending on the nature of the product, cancellation rights may not apply to certain goods, including, where legally applicable:

  • goods made to your specifications or clearly personalised;

  • goods that are liable to deteriorate or expire rapidly;

  • sealed goods that are not suitable for return for health protection or hygiene reasons where the seal has been broken after delivery;

  • sealed audio, video recordings or computer software where the seal has been broken;

  • goods which, after delivery, become inseparably mixed with other items due to their nature;

  • newspapers, periodicals or magazines, other than certain subscription contracts; and

  • other products or contracts specifically excluded from cancellation rights by applicable law.

These exceptions will only be applied where legally permitted.

For clothing and fashion products, an exclusion for hygiene reasons does not automatically apply merely because an item has been tried on. Any hygiene-related exception will be applied only where the applicable legal requirements are satisfied.
